Volleyball Preview: Steward Spartans vs. Nansemond-Suffolk Academy Saints

Steward is 2-8 against Nansemond-Suffolk Academy since October of 2018 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Tuesday. The Spartans will venture away from home to face off against the Saints at 6:00 p.m.

On Thursday, Steward came up short against Norfolk Collegiate and fell 3-1. While the Spartans didn't get the win, they did start the game off strong, beating the Mighty Oaks 25-20 in the first set.

Steward started the match hot and won the first set, but they struggled down the stretch and lost the last three. The match finished with set scores of 20-25, 25-22, 25-22, 25-11.

The losing side was boosted by Greenlee Murray, who had 16 digs and three assists. She has been hot recently, having posted 13 or more digs the last three times she's played.

Meanwhile, Nansemond-Suffolk Academy got the win against Hampton Roads Academy on Thursday by a conclusive 3-0. The win made it back-to-back victories for the Saints.

Nansemond-Suffolk Academy never let Hampton Roads Academy on the board, but things got pretty close in the first set.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-22, 25-17, 25-17.

Nansemond-Suffolk Academy's victory bumped their record up to 7-11. As for Steward, their loss dropped their record down to 11-13.

Here's a few offensive stats to keep an eye on ahead of Tuesday's match: Steward has really dialed in their serving this season, having averaged 12.8 aces per game. However, it's not like Nansemond-Suffolk Academy struggles in that department as they've been averaging 5.2 aces. Given these competing strengths, it'll be interesting to see how their clash plays out.

Steward might still be hurting after the 3-0 defeat they got from Nansemond-Suffolk Academy in their previous meeting back in October of 2024. A big factor in that loss was the dominant performance of the Saints' Jossy Byars, who had 34 assists and 18 digs.
